Overview

Whether you are an absolute beginner or a seasoned artist, join Brentford Nudes for a life drawing class within our breathtaking Upper Drawing Room.

Celebrating London Festival of Architecture, explore the fascinating relationship between the human form and the spaces we inhabit. From Vitruvius’s ideal proportions to the practicalities of gallery design, our bodies shape the built environment. This unique life drawing session, delves into the ‘architecture of the body in space’ and discovering how our physical presence influences the world around us.

The class will begin with a series of dynamic warm up poses followed by longer poses with our model. Your host Angela Chico will be on hand to give tips throughout.

About Thursday Lates

Pitzhanger stays open until 8pm on the first Thursday of every month offering visitors an after-hours chance to view the exhibitions, and to join a wide range of events and activities, or simply enjoy a glass of something in our café/bar. Please note that some talks and events may require additional tickets so do check the website for details ahead of your visit.
